The Sun Hydraulics FPFKMBE924N (FPFKMBE924N) is a pilot-operated, normally closed, electroproportional throttle with reverse flow check. This component is designed to control hydraulic fluid flow with precision and reliability. Its electroproportional functionality allows for variable control of fluid flow rates, making it suitable for applications that require fine-tuned adjustments and efficient energy use. The reverse flow check feature ensures that fluid can only flow in the designated direction, preventing backflow and potential system damage. This valve is particularly useful in systems where precise control over actuation speed or force is necessary, such as in industrial automation or mobile machinery. Its pilot-operated design provides enhanced stability and responsiveness under varying load conditions, making it ideal for demanding hydraulic applications.
